Hi Everyone, I took my ex-tenants to court for their unpaid rent.

Although the judge has ordered them to pay, they ignored the order completely. As one of them is receiving partial benefits, I can’t apply for an earning attachment order.

I am wondering if there’s any other way that I could recover the money they owe?

For the one who does work, I applied for an earnings attachment order, the judge asked her to pay £50 per month directly, for the amount owed. It will take her nearly 17 years to clear the debts, she is probably not going to work for that long. I wonder if it is worth asking the court to reconsider?

Has anyone had a similar experience, who may be able to give me some advice please.
